Authorizing the Laying-off of Thistle Street, Shamrock
Street, Rose Street, in the Town of Napier South Sub-
division No. 6, of a Width of not less than 66 ft.
Department of Lands,
Wellington, 19th June, 1911.
IN pursuance of the power and authority conferred upon
me by section 15 of the Land Act, 1908, I, David
Buddo, Acting Minister of Lands, do hereby authorize the
laying-off of Thistle Street, Shamrock Street, Rose Street,
in the Town of Napier South Subdivision No. 6, Hawke's
Bay Land District, of a width of not less than 66 ft. instead of 99 ft.
D. BUDDO,
Acting Minister of Lands.

Notifying Land in the Otago Land District subject to the
Provisions of the Land for Settlements Act, 1908.
Office of Board of Land Purchase Commissioners,
Wellington, 19th June, 1911.
PURSUANT to the provisions of the Land for Settle-
ments Act, 1908, and its amendments, I hereby
notify that the undermentioned Crown land, being the
land known as the Aviemore Settlement, which has been
acquired under the said Acts, is subject to the said Acts
as from 28th February, 1911.
SCHEDULE.
AVIEMORE SETTLEMENT.
All that parcel of land situated in the Otago Land Dis-
trict, and containing by admeasurement 30 acres, more or
less, being Section 3, Block II, Otamatakau District, and
bounded as follows : On the north-east by Kurow-Omarama
Road, 2184'3 links; on the south-east by Run 243E, 1373'4
links; on the south-west by Run 243E, 2184'3 links: and
on the north-west by Run 243E, 1373'4 links : be all the
aforesaid linkages more or less : and as the areas are more
particularly shown on the plan marked L. and S. 20057.
deposited in the Head Office of the Department of Lands
and Survey, in Wellington, and thereon edged with red.
D. BUDDO,
Acting Minister of Lands.

St. Joseph's Industrial School, Wellington.
Education Department,
Wellington, 9th June, 1911.
NOTICE is hereby given that St. Joseph's Industrial
School, lately maintained at Hawkestone Street,
Wellington, is now maintained at the Upper Hutt. and
will be known in future as "St. Joseph's Industrial School,
Upper Hutt." The use of the said premises in Wellington
for industrial-school purposes is now discontinued.
GEO. FOWLDS,
Minister of Education.

Old Post-office Site and Building, Takaka, for Lease by
Public Tender.
General Post Office,
Wellington, 19th June, 1911.
NOTICE is hereby given that written tenders will be
received at this office up to 5 o'clock p.m. on Tues-
day, the 18th day of July, 1911, for a lease of the under-
mentioned land and building under Part I of the Public
Reserves and Domains Act, 1908.
SCHEDULE.
The old post-office site and building at Takaka, at present
occupied by the Collingwood County Council, with the
exception of the small shed at the back of the building.
Area : One rood, part of section numbered 18 on square
numbered 11 of the plan of the Provincial District of
Nelson, having a frontage of 100 links to the Waitapu
Road by a depth of 250 links at right angles thereto.
Term : Fourteen years.
Conditions : Fences to be kept in good repair, and land
to be kept clear of noxious weeds.
D. ROBERTSON,
Secretary.
